什么是重构 在软件开发领域,重构是一项至关重要的实践,它对于提升代码质量、增强软件的可维护性和可扩展性起着关键作用。简单来说,重构就是在不改变软件外在行为的前提下,对其内部结构进行修改,以优化代码结构、提升代码的可读性、降低复杂性并提高可维护性。 从本质上讲,重构并非是对功能的添加或修改,而是对现有